Does Dubai have 5G?
In May 2019, with 5G-capable handsets now available to UAE customers, the Etisalat network was opened for full mobile use. By February 2023, the 5G network served all main urban areas and many connecting highways, including Abu Dhabi, Dubai, Sharjah, Fujairah, Ras Al-Kaimah, and Umm Al-Quwain, with a population coverage of 97%.
How many 5G stations are there in the UAE?
5G is well-deployed in major urban areas and along main transport routes, but less so in more rural areas. The UAE is estimated to have approximately 7,000 5G base stations, representing seven stations per 10,000 residents. The two principal network operators (Etisalat by e& and Du) as well as the main VMNO Virgin Mobile offer 5G connectivity.
Why is the UAE a leader in 5G mobile technology?
The UAE is a leader in the adoption of 5G mobile technology in the Middle East and North Africa (MENA) region, mainly due to government support as enterprises invest heavily in digitizing their IT infrastructure. The UAE’s telecom regulator expects to bring all inhabited areas of the country under 5G network coverage by the end of 2025.

What is the UAE Strategy for 5G & beyond?
This is in line with the UAE Strategy for 5G and Beyond (2020-2025), which includes enabling and achieving long-term social and economic benefits in various areas such as manufacturing, transportation, healthcare, and education. 6 The TDRA published a White Paper on 5G roles in Industry Digitalisation in the UAE in October 2022 (White Paper).
When did 5G start in the UAE?
The first full commercial 5G mobile service in the MEA region was introduced by Etisalat in the United Arab Emirates (UAE) in May 2019, followed closely by its domestic rival Du the following month. Etisalat switched on the region’s first pre-commercial 5G networks in select Abu Dhabi and Dubai locations in January 2018.
